3C”S TOASTMASTERS
3C’s Toastmasters, otherwise known as Collin County Communicators meets every week on Wednesday evening from 7:00 PM until 8:00 PM at the Chamber office. This is an opportunity for members and nonmembers to learn or brush up on their public speaking skills. For more information call Nigel Reed at 972-673-4199 or email to Nigel@sysadmininc.com.
NEWCOMER FRIENDS OF GREATER PLANO
Newcomer Friends of Greater Plano is a social organization of warm, caring women, which provides a supportive environment for new and established residents of Plano and the surrounding areas.
In May they will hold a Spring Luncheon with entertainer Dave Tanner. RSVP by May 8 at www.newcomerfriends.org.
